基于能量均衡的认知无线电双向中继网络能耗优化研究

摘    要:针对使用电池的认知无线电(CR)节点能量消耗不均衡导致系统节点生存时间短,能量利用率低的问题,提出了一种基于双向中继(TWR)的无线通信能耗均衡通信系统.该系统由源节点、目的节点、双向中继及其接收节点组成,每个节点分配初始能量,节点间通过合理的方法设置发射功率来实现功率归一化处理,从而平衡节点间的能量,防止网络中部分节点由于能量耗尽过早消亡,实现无线通信网络中节点能量的均衡和网络生存寿命的最大化.仿真结果表明,本文提出的基于能量归一化均衡算法可最大化能效,并能提高能量利用率的同时延长系统生存时间.

关 键 词:双向中继  能量归一化  能量均衡  能量效率

Energy Consumption Optimization of Cognitive Radio Relay Network Based on Energy Normalization

Abstract:In view of the problem that the node energy consumption is not balanced and system survival time unbalanced,put forward a kind of energy consumption balancing communication system based on two-way relay (TWR) in Cognitive radio networks (CRN).The system consists of source node and destination node,two-way relay (TWR) and receiving nodes,each node distribute initial energy,through setting up reasonable transmitted power to achieve power normalization processing,balance the node energy,in order to prevent the part of the node perish due to run out of energy,to realize Cognitive radio network (CRN) node energy equilibrium and maximize survival of life.Simulation results show that the proposed based on the normalized energy equalization algorithm can maximize efficiency,extend the system survival time while improve the utilization ratio of energy.
Keywords:two-way relay  energy normalization  energy equilibrium  energy efficiency
